Financial Performance - Fourth-quarter 2024 net income attributable to Plains All American was $36 million, a decrease of 88% compared to $312 million in Q4 2023[4] - Full-year 2024 net income attributable to Plains All American was $772 million, down 37% from $1.23 billion in 2023[4] - Fourth-quarter 2024 adjusted EBITDA attributable to Plains All American was $729 million, slightly below the $737 million in Q4 2023, representing a 1% decrease[5] - Full-year 2024 adjusted EBITDA attributable to Plains All American was $2.78 billion, a 3% increase from $2.71 billion in 2023[5] - The company generated approximately $1.17 billion in adjusted free cash flow for the full year 2024, a decrease of 31% compared to $1.8 billion in 2023[5] - Revenues for Q4 2024 were $12,402 million, a decrease of 2.3% from $12,698 million in Q4 2023; total revenues for the year increased by 2.8% to $50,073 million from $48,712 million[23] - Operating income for Q4 2024 was $87 million, down 79.6% from $426 million in Q4 2023; total operating income for the year decreased by 22.0% to $1,178 million from $1,510 million[23] - Net income attributable to Plains All American Pipeline (PAA) for Q4 2024 was $36 million, a significant drop of 88.5% compared to $312 million in Q4 2023; total net income for the year decreased by 37.1% to $772 million from $1,230 million[23] Cash Flow and Distributions - Adjusted Free Cash Flow after Distributions for the year was impacted by cash distributions paid to preferred and common unitholders, which totaled $175 million for Series A and $78 million for Series B preferred unitholders[28] - Cash and cash equivalents at the end of 2024 were $348 million, down from $450 million at the end of 2023, reflecting a net decrease in cash flow[30] - The company reported net cash provided by operating activities of $2,490 million for the year, a decrease from $2,727 million in 2023[30] - The company experienced a net cash outflow of $1,504 million from investing activities, significantly higher than the $702 million outflow in 2023, indicating increased capital expenditures or investments[30] - Cash distribution paid per common unit increased to $0.3175 in Q4 2024 from $0.2675 in Q4 2023, marking a rise of 18.7%[36] - Total cash distributions for the year were $1,145 million, an increase from $989 million in 2023[40] Assets and Liabilities - Total assets decreased to $26,562 million in 2024 from $27,355 million in 2023, primarily due to reductions in property and equipment and intangible assets[24] - Total liabilities decreased slightly to $13,466 million in 2024 from $13,623 million in 2023, with total debt also decreasing to $7,621 million from $7,751 million[25] - Long-term debt-to-total book capitalization increased to 42% in 2024 from 41% in 2023, indicating a slight increase in leverage[25] - Total adjusted net income for the twelve months ended December 31, 2024, was $1.318 billion, compared to $1.250 billion in 2023, reflecting a growth of 5.4%[33] Segment Performance - Revenues from crude oil segment for Q4 2024 were $11,959 million, while NGL segment revenues were $535 million, compared to $12,187 million and $623 million respectively in Q4 2023[44] - Segment Adjusted EBITDA for crude oil was $569 million in Q4 2024, slightly up from $563 million in Q4 2023, while NGL segment Adjusted EBITDA decreased to $154 million from $169 million[44] - Crude Oil segment revenues for the twelve months ended December 31, 2024, were $48,720 million, an increase from $47,174 million in 2023, representing a growth of 3.3%[46] - NGL segment revenues decreased to $1,724 million in 2024 from $1,935 million in 2023, a decline of 10.9%[46] - Segment Adjusted EBITDA for the Crude Oil segment was $2,276 million in 2024, up from $2,163 million in 2023, reflecting a growth of 5.2%[46] Strategic Initiatives and Future Outlook - Plains All American expects full-year 2025 adjusted EBITDA attributable to be in the range of $2.80 billion to $2.95 billion[4] - The company announced a distribution increase of $0.25 per unit, representing a 20% increase in annualized distribution compared to 2024 levels[4] - The company plans to retain excess Adjusted Free Cash Flow after distributions for future capital expenditures and debt reduction[40] - The company is focused on strategic opportunities including acquisitions and joint ventures to enhance operational capabilities and market presence[57] Risks and Challenges - The company highlighted potential risks including fluctuations in crude oil prices and competition in the midstream services market, which could impact future performance[57] - PAA is impacted by various risks including weather interference, regulatory changes, and production level fluctuations in the Permian Basin[59] - The company faces challenges related to customer performance under contracts, which may affect revenue recognition[59] - The effectiveness of risk management activities is crucial for PAA's operational stability[59] - The company is exposed to fluctuations in debt and equity markets, which can affect its long-term incentive plans[59] - PAA's ability to attract and retain key personnel is essential for maintaining operational efficiency[59] Company Overview - The company is headquartered in Houston, Texas, and is publicly traded as a master limited partnership[61] - Plains All American Pipeline (PAA) and Plains GP Holdings (PAGP) are significant players in the North American energy infrastructure and logistics sector[61]

Group 1 - Plains GP Holdings (PAGP) shares increased by 6.1% to close at $19.93, following a notable trading volume compared to typical sessions, contrasting with a 1.6% loss over the past four weeks [1] - The surge in shares is attributed to sustained demand for Plains GP's midstream services, supported by a favorable crude price environment and expected rising demand for crude products in the U.S. [2] - Plains GP has announced three new acquisitions, enhancing its presence in key crude-producing regions such as the Permian, Eagle Ford, and Mid-Con basins, which is a significant growth driver for the company [2] Group 2 - The company is expected to report quarterly earnings of $0.28 per share, reflecting a year-over-year increase of 3.7%, with revenues projected at $13.16 billion, also up 3.7% from the previous year [3] - The consensus EPS estimate for Plains GP has remained unchanged over the last 30 days, indicating that stock price movements may not continue without trends in earnings estimate revisions [4] - Plains GP is part of the Zacks Oil and Gas - Production and Pipelines industry, with a current Zacks Rank of 3 (Hold) [4]

Financial Performance - Reported net income attributable to Plains All American of $220 million for Q3 2024, an 8% increase from $203 million in Q3 2023[2] - Adjusted EBITDA attributable to Plains All American was $659 million for Q3 2024, remaining stable compared to $662 million in Q3 2023[2] - Revenues for the three months ended September 30, 2024, increased to $12,743 million, up 5.6% from $12,071 million in the same period of 2023[13] - Operating income rose to $347 million for the three months ended September 30, 2024, compared to $234 million in the prior year, reflecting a 48.3% increase[13] - Net income for the three months ended September 30, 2024, was $312 million, compared to $279 million for the same period in 2023, representing an increase of 11.8%[20] - For the nine months ended September 30, 2024, revenues were $37,671 million, up from $36,014 million in the same period of 2023, marking a growth of 4.6%[33] - Operating income for the nine months ended September 30, 2024, was $1,090 million, consistent with the previous year's figure of $1,085 million[33] - Net income attributable to PAGP for the nine months ended September 30, 2024, was $736 million, compared to $918 million for the same period in 2023, indicating a decrease of 19.8%[33] Cash Flow and Liquidity - Net cash provided by operating activities was $692 million in Q3 2024, compared to $85 million in Q3 2023[2] - Adjusted Free Cash Flow for 2024 is anticipated to be approximately $1.45 billion, excluding changes in Assets & Liabilities[1] - Adjusted Free Cash Flow for the three months ended September 30, 2024, was $401 million, compared to a negative $386 million in the same period of 2023[23] - Cash and cash equivalents increased to $640 million as of September 30, 2024, from $450 million at the end of 2023[14] - The company reported a net cash used in financing activities of $330 million for the nine months ended September 30, 2024, a decrease from $1,409 million in the same period of 2023, indicating improved cash management[16] Segment Performance - The Crude Oil Segment Adjusted EBITDA increased by 4% to $577 million in Q3 2024, driven by higher tariff volumes and contributions from acquisitions[3] - The NGL Segment Adjusted EBITDA decreased by 26% to $73 million in Q3 2024, primarily due to lower weighted average frac spreads[4] - Revenues for Crude Oil segment reached $12,444 million for the three months ended September 30, 2024, up from $11,934 million in the same period of 2023, indicating a year-over-year increase of approximately 4.3%[26] - Adjusted EBITDA for the crude oil segment was $1,707 million for the nine months ended September 30, 2024, compared to $1,600 million for the same period in 2023, reflecting a growth of 6.7%[29] Capital Expenditures and Investments - Total investment capital expenditures for the nine months ended September 30, 2024, were $232 million, up from $221 million in the same period of 2023, indicating an increase of approximately 5%[17] - Maintenance capital expenditures for the nine months ended September 30, 2024, were $135 million, compared to $107 million for the same period in 2023, indicating a 26.2% increase[27] - Maintenance capital expenditures for the three months ended September 30, 2024, were $69 million, compared to $60 million in the same period of 2023, indicating a rise of 15%[20] Debt and Leverage - Plains All American exited Q3 2024 with a leverage ratio of 3.0x, below the target range of 3.25x – 3.75x[1] - The company reported a total debt of $7,977 million as of September 30, 2024, up from $7,751 million at the end of 2023[14] - Long-term debt-to-total book capitalization ratio was 41% as of September 30, 2024, consistent with the ratio from December 31, 2023[14] Market and Economic Outlook - The company faces risks including fluctuations in crude oil prices, which could significantly impact its operational margins and commercial opportunities[36] - Future outlook includes potential impacts from economic conditions, supply chain issues, and regulatory changes affecting the energy sector[36] - The company is focused on maintaining its competitive position amidst market pressures and potential declines in crude oil demand[37] Credit Rating and Financial Stability - Moody's upgraded Plains All American's credit rating from Baa3 to Baa2 with a stable outlook, reflecting improved financial stability[1]
